Slade Prizes (Slade School of Fine Art), 1872-1952
Start Date: September 1872
End Date: 1952
Type: Competition
Description: Various prizes were awarded to students each year. From 1872-1873 to 1879-1880 prizes were only awarded for drawing and painting. The first prize for modelling/sculpture was awarded in 1883-1884.
In 1883-1884 nine female students were awarded prizes for modelling and two male. Prizes were then awarded in the following years, 1889-1890 to 1891-1892, 1894-1895 to 1898-1899.
In 1888-1889 an award was also given for designs for the 'Slade medal'.
Numerous prizes were still being offered to students by the school in 1951-1952, the last year sampled for this database.
Policy: The majority of the prizes were open to men and women.
